/* CSS Document */

*{padding: 0px;margin: 0px; -moz-box-sizing: border-box;-webkit-box-sizing: border-box;box-sizing: border-box;}

.container{width:1000px!important;margin:0 auto;position:relative;}
body{background:url("../img/bg.png");background-size:cover}

/* css rest */
html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td,
article, aside, canvas, details, embed, 
figure, figcaption, footer, header, hgroup, 
menu, nav, output, ruby, section, summary,
time, mark, audio, video {
	margin: 0;
	padding: 0;
	border: 0;
	font-size: 100%;
	font: inherit;
	vertical-align: baseline;
}
/*end reset*/
a, a:active, a:focus {
   outline: none;
}

@font-face{font-family:Bungee;src: url("../fonts/Bungee-Regular.ttf");}
@font-face{font-family:Akrobat;src: url("../fonts/Akrobat-Black.ttf");}

.clear {clear: both;}

.header {height:188px;width:1000px;margin:0 auto;padding-top:8px;}

.tanggal{width:225px;height:15px;margin:77px 0 0 80px;float:left;} .waktu {color:#000;font-family:'Akrobat';font-weight: bolder;}
.logo {width:250px;height:83px;margin:0 auto;}
.marquees{width:355px;height:20px;float: right;margin-top:-8px;}
.marquees marquee {width:320px;font-family: 'Akrobat';font-size:16px;z-index:1;}

#password {margin:25px 0 15px 60px;} #username{margin:55px 0 0 60px;}
#username, #password {width:200px;height:50px;padding:10px 0 0 0;float: left;}
.btnlogin{width:139px;height:51px;float:left;background:url("../img/btn-masuk.png") no-repeat;border:none;cursor:pointer;vertical-align:middle;color:transparent;}
.btndaftar{width:139px;height:51px;float:left;background:url("../img/btn-daftar.png") no-repeat;border:none;cursor:pointer;vertical-align:middle;color:transparent;}
.btnlogin:hover,.btndaftar:hover{opacity:0.8;}
#user, #pass {width: 200px;height: 28px;border: none;border-radius: 3px;padding: 0 10px 0 10px;font-size: 18px;font-family:'Akrobat';background-color: transparent;}

.menu-bg {height:118px;width:1000px;background: url("../img/header.png") top center; margin-top:-25px;float:left;}
.menu-l {width:260px;height: 20px;float: left;margin: 45px 10px 0 60px}
.menu-l li,.menu-t li, .menu-r li {display: inline-block;position: relative;color:white;float: left;} 
.menu-l li a,.menu-t li a {font-family:'Akrobat'; color:white;text-decoration:none;padding:0px 0 0 15px;display:block;font-size:17px;}
.menu-l li a:hover, .menu-r li a:hover, .menu-t li a:hover{color:#fcbf29;}

.menu-r{width:260px;height: 40px;float: left;margin-top:40px}
.menu-r li {margin-left:13px;} 
.menu-r img{display:block;margin-left:20px;}
.menu-r li a{font-family:'Akrobat'; color:white;text-decoration:none;padding:0px 0 0 8px;display:block;font-size: 15px;}

.menu-t{width:300px;height:60px;float: left;margin:30px 25px 0}
.menu-t img{display:block;}
.menu-t li a{padding: 0;}
.menu-t li:nth-child(1){margin:5px 0 0 10px;}.menu-t li:nth-child(2){margin:-5px 0 0 15px;}.menu-t li:nth-child(3){margin:5px 0 0 25px;}

.content {height: auto;}

.slider {width:656px;height:400px;float:left;}
.logform {width:314px;height:255px;float:left;margin:69px 0 0 15px;background:url("../img/logins.png") no-repeat;padding-left:20px;}

.jp-bg{width: 1000px;height:153px;float: left;background:url("../img/jp-bg.png") no-repeat;padding-top:60px;}
.jackpot-poker {width: 500px;height: 80px;float: left;padding-left:100px;}
.jackpot-domino {width: 500px;height:80px;float: left;padding-left:150px;}
#jpdomino, #jppoker {font-family: Bungee; font-size: 32px;color:#edfffc;}

.last-bg{width:1000px;height:268px;float:left;background:url("../img/last-bg.png") no-repeat;}
#last-deposit,#last-withdraw{float:left;width:345px;height:200px;margin-top:65px;padding:24px 0 0 80px;}
.last{width:250px;height: 165px;color:white;font-family:Akrobat;font-size:19px;text-align:center;letter-spacing: 1px;}
.last tr td:nth-child(1){text-align:left;} .last tr td:nth-child(2){text-align:center;} .last tr td:nth-child(3){text-align:right;}  

.games {width:310px;height: 270px;float: left;text-align:center;padding-top:70px}

.bank {width: 1000px; height:50px;float: left;margin:15px 0 12px 0;}
.line {width: 1000px;height:10px;background:url("../img/line.png") no-repeat;float:left;}

.content-text{width:100%;height: auto;float: left;color:#000;text-align: center; font-family:Arial;font-weight:bolder;padding: 25px 30px 15px;}
.content-text h1 {font-size: 34px;margin-bottom:0.5rem;} .content-text h2{font-size: 30px;margin-bottom:0.5rem;} .content-text p {font-size: 16px;margin-bottom:1rem;letter-spacing:0.5px;line-height:1.2;}

.availbro{width: 1000px;height:80px;float:left;padding-left:200px;margin-bottom:15px;font:italic bolder 18px Arial;}
.device{width:175px;height:80px;float: left;margin-right:200px;text-align:center;}
.bro{width:355px;height:80px;float:left;text-align:center;}

.copbg{width:100%;height:40px; background:url("../img/footlin.png");background-size:cover;float:left;}
.copy{font:20px Arial;color:#fff;text-align: center;padding-top:10px;}

